Safran is looking for a motivated Quality Engineer that will be working closely with our suppliers, acting as the lead technical liaison to drive robust correction and improvement to our supplied parts.

Essential Job Functions:
Work closely with Receiving Inspection personnel to verify suspect conditions and ensure accurate recording of non-conformities.
Investigate non-conformities by accurately quantifying issues and collecting appropriate evidence for engineering review and supplier feedback.
Participate on Material Review Boards to decide how non-conforming product should be dispositioned.
Act as the primary technical liaison between Safran and its suppliers to effectively communicate issues and improvements.
Drive suppliers to implement robust corrective actions through use of the 8D Problem Solving methodology.
Develop/Improve Safran's Processes of managing Non-Conformance & Corrective Action with its Suppliers to facilitate rapid and robust correction.
Perform product audits at suppliers to identify gaps driving non-conformities.
Update and create Quality Inspection Plans to enable capture of emerging issues upon receipt.
Assist in the development of dimensional and process control strategies with suppliers of critical components.
Internally communicate with Engineering, Purchasing, and Program Management on opportunities for quality improvement.
Internally escalate potential product/process quality issues and develop solutions to resolve them.
Work with the Operations Support Engineers to resolve supplier issues on the manufacturing floor.
Regular predictable attendance is required.
Up to 50% travel, supporting suppliers with product issues and performing product audits.
Performs other related duties as assigned.

Candidate skills & requirements

Qualifications:
Bachelor's degree from an accredited institution.
Ability to interpret drawing requirements, including use of GD&T. Knowledgeable in engineering change processes.
Experienced at utilizing industry standards and specifications to verify product and process conformity. Applied knowledge in Quality Management System requirements and supplied part verification processes.
Experienced in Non-Conforming Material and Material Review Board processes in a QMS.
Expert in leading teams thru structured improvement and problem solving methodologies. Expert in the use of the various tools and sub-processes that ensure success when make improvements and corrections.
Demonstrated experience of manufacturing processes with respect to 4 or more of these areas: electronic assemblies, complex assemblies, machining, welding, metal and plastic stamping/forming, injection molding technologies, tooling, fixtures and gauges.
Experienced in performing product audits in one or more of the above areas.
Experience with an ERP system in a manufacturing environment.
Expert in the use of basic measurement equipment. Knowledgeable in the capabilities and limitations of various complex measuring equipment.
Effective Technical Communicator, both written and oral.
7 years of related experience in Quality Engineering or similar role.
Proficient in the use of Excel to: analyze measurement data, identify/track trends in event logs, and develop metrics to track drivers.
Results oriented with the ability to manage and maintain momentum on a large number of issues and projects concurrently.
Demonstrated AS9100/ISO9001 knowledge.
